How these calculators work, and why the engine matters

Most astrology websites answer your questions with lookup tables: pre-typed lists of dates mapped to signs, copied from site to site for decades. That approach breaks exactly where precision matters most: cusp birthdays, Moon sign boundary days, ayanamsa differences, and the Lunar New Year window. Every astronomical tool on this page instead computes real planetary positions with the Moshier ephemeris, the same class of calculation professional chart software uses, so a birthday on the Aries–Taurus boundary gets an actual answer, not a guess.

The second design decision is privacy. Birth details are sensitive data, and there is no technical reason a calculator needs to phone them home. Every tool here runs completely in your browser: the page loads, the mathematics happens on your device, and nothing is transmitted or stored. You can disconnect from the internet after the page loads and the calculators keep working.

What is the difference between the Western and Vedic settings?
Western (tropical) astrology anchors the zodiac to the seasons; Vedic (sidereal) anchors it to the fixed stars, currently offset by about 24 degrees. The birth chart calculator computes both with one toggle, so you can compare your placements in each system.
How does the kundli matching calculator work?
It computes both partners’ Moon nakshatras and rasis from real planetary positions, then scores the eight classical kootas: Varna, Vashya, Tara, Yoni, Graha Maitri, Gana, Bhakoot, and Nadi, totalling 36 points, with dosha warnings where they apply.
What guna milan score is needed for marriage?
Classical texts set 18 out of 36 as the minimum acceptable score. 18 to 24 is average, 25 to 32 very good, and above 32 excellent. Doshas in Nadi or Bhakoot call for a fuller chart review regardless of the total.
Do I need my exact birth time?
For your rising sign, houses, and boundary cases in kundli matching, yes. For your Sun sign, life path number, Chinese zodiac, and usually your Moon sign, the date alone is enough. Each tool tells you what it needs.
What is a life path number?
Your life path number reduces your full birth date to a single digit or a master number (11, 22, 33). It is numerology’s core signature, describing your fundamental nature and the lessons your life keeps returning to.
Can I check compatibility without knowing birth times?
Yes. The love compatibility tool needs only two zodiac signs, and kundli matching works with birth dates alone in most cases, since the Moon changes nakshatra roughly once per day. Birth times sharpen boundary cases.

Why does my Chinese zodiac differ from year tables?
The Chinese zodiac year begins at Lunar New Year, between late January and mid February, not on January 1. Anyone born in that window belongs to the previous animal, which the calculator handles automatically.
